由于开发需要,很多时候需要使用到iframe框架,即子页面,子页面使用是挺方便的,但如果子页面呢需要跳转整个页面呢,比如我就遇到了一个问题,我子页面有个功能需要登录,所以连接的是登录页面,但登录页面只在子页面中显示,这就显得很不合理了,在这里,我介绍几种方法,
第一种,是比较大众的方法,及子页面内<a>标签的整个页面跳转,只需在<a>
标签中添加"target=_parent"即可。
第二种是在head标签之间加入<base target="_parent" />
则子页面内的所有跳转默认是父页面一起跳。
第三种,也就是我遇到的,在js中跳转,window.location.href();这就尴尬了,因为window这种跳转是没有target属性的,这时,你可以使用取个巧,让父页面跟着一起跳转,即在window.location.href=url后面加上window.parent.location.href=url;
注:如果需要登录之后再跳转回来,可以在url末尾添加 "?preurl="+parent.location.href;
即可再跳回父页面
分享到:
相关推荐
在***中实现点击左边页面链接时,右边iframe框架显示对应链接页面的内容,是一种常见的网页布局模式,经常被用于后台管理系统中。这种布局允许用户在一个窗口内操作导航,而在另一个子窗口内查看和处理内容,从而...
在网页设计中,为了提供更好的用户体验,我们常常需要在用户点击导航链接时,不重新加载整个页面而是仅替换部分内容。这种技术可以借助`iframe`(Inline Frame)元素来实现。`iframe`允许我们在一个HTML文档中嵌入另...
在网页开发过程中,经常遇到的一个问题是当嵌入在`iframe`中的内容出现错误时,如何让用户直接看到这个错误所在的框架或者跳转到一个特定的页面。这个问题涉及到前端JavaScript以及后端.NET(如C#)的处理方式。下面...
"iframe实现页面跳转"这个话题涉及到如何利用iframe来实现在不刷新整个页面的情况下,动态加载不同的网页内容,从而提供更好的用户体验。 首先,iframe的使用方式是在HTML代码中插入`<iframe>`标签,指定其`src`...
下面将详细探讨如何使用Iframe实现TAB页面切换,以及与之相关的知识点。 首先,理解Iframe的基本结构: ```html <iframe src="http://example.com" width="400" height="300"></iframe> ``` `src`属性指定要加载的...
asp.net iframe框架跳转以及定时轮询,子页面将新窗口打开到父窗体指定的iframe框架中,以及http_request轮询方法!时间匆忙只简单的写了简单应用。有时间在完善,希望能帮助到需要的朋友!
例如,左侧导航栏选择不同的模块,对应的右侧主区域通过动态改变iframe的`src`来加载相应的内容,这样可以实现单页应用的效果,减少页面跳转带来的延迟。 为了更好地适应后台管理框架,我们还需要关注以下几点: 1...
然而,`iframe`的使用有时也会带来一些问题,比如在后台管理系统中,当用户在某个子页面(如二级菜单页面)操作时,如果`iframe`刷新,可能会导致页面跳转回首页,这显然不是用户期望的行为。针对这个问题,我们需要...
在iOS中,当`iframe`内的子页面高度超过父页面时,若子页面触发弹框,弹框可能会出现在视口下方,因为它的位置是相对于子页面而不是视口进行定位。这在Android系统中通常不会发生,因此开发者需要采取特定的策略来...
然而,在IFrame(Inline Frame)环境中,Session的管理变得复杂,因为IFrame本质上是一个嵌入到主页面中的子窗口或框架,它可以加载来自不同源的网页。这种结构可能导致Session信息在IFrame与其父窗口或同一页面中的...
6. **路由**:Angular的路由系统允许根据URL导航到不同的组件视图,实现单页应用的页面跳转。 7. **服务**:自定义服务用于封装业务逻辑和数据处理,可注入到任何需要的地方。 8. **TypeScript支持**:Angular原生...
#### 二、为什么需要让iframe页面跳转到父窗口? 在实际开发过程中,有时候我们需要在`iframe`内部进行操作来影响其外部的页面。例如,当用户在`iframe`内部完成某个操作(如登录验证)后,可能需要返回到父页面...
在JavaScript中,`location.href` 是一个非常常用的属性,它用于获取或设置当前页面的URL。当我们在网页中处理框架(iframe)时,有时...在处理涉及框架的页面跳转时,理解这些概念可以帮助我们更好地控制页面的行为。
因此,你可以像使用`window.location`一样使用`self.location`来进行页面跳转。例如: ```javascript self.location = 'target.aspx'; ``` ##### 6. **`top.location`** `top.location`用于指向顶级窗口的`...
本文将详细讲解三种不同情况下的框架页面跳转,包括如何跳出框架、跳转到指定名称的框架以及针对当前页iframe的跳转。 1. 跳出框架,在父页面跳转 当页面被包含在一个或多个框架内时,如果想要进行页面跳转,但目标...
然而,在使用`<iframe>`时,有时我们需要监测其内容的变化,特别是当`<iframe>`中的源地址(src属性)发生改变时。 #### 1. 使用`window.onbeforeunload`事件监测IFrame内容变化 根据提供的代码示例,主要关注点...
这种方式适用于子框架或iframe内的页面跳转至父窗口中的另一个页面。通过修改`parent`对象的`location`属性来实现跳转。 #### 2. 使用`window.open`方法 ```javascript window.open('目标URL'); ``` 此方法用于在...
在用户会话过期的情况下,即使用户被重定向到了登录页面,如果这个登录页面是在iframe中打开的,浏览器将只会刷新iframe内的内容,而不会跳出iframe框架。 为了解决这个问题,可以在登录页面的部分加入JavaScript...
通过在主页面中嵌入多个子页面(iframe),可以实现页面间的独立加载和刷新,避免了传统页面跳转导致的整个页面刷新,提高了工作效率。每个iframe可以看作是一个独立的工作区,用户可以在不同的工作区进行操作而互不...
3. **统一登录状态管理**:利用Cookie、Session或现代前端框架(如React、Vue)的状态管理库(如Redux、Vuex),可以在整个应用程序范围内统一管理和维护用户的登录状态。 4. **友好的错误处理**:设计合理的错误...